The visiting Cincinnati Reds hope for a solid performance on Monday as they look to pick up a win at PNC Park against the Pittsburgh Pirates.

Francisco Liriano gets the call for the Pittsburgh Pirates and he will try to build on a 0-3 mark. In the other dugout, Mike Leake brings a 2-1 ledger to the game for the Cincinnati Reds as he tries to quiet the Pirates bats.

How Cincinnati Reds vs Pittsburgh Pirates Stats Matchup

At the plate, Pittsburgh owns the No. 21 ranking for hits at 8.16 per game. By contrast, the Cincinnati Reds are rated No. 12 in the same category at 8.72 per game.

Comparing defensive stats, Cincinnati owns the No. 7-rated road mark, allowing 3.78 runs per game on the highway. Pittsburgh, on the other hand, rates No. 12 in scoring at home.

Cincinnati looks to continue its winning ways following a victory last time out against the Cubs, an 8-2 final on Sunday in support of Homer Bailey at Wrigley Field.

In their last action, Pittsburgh was a 3-2 loser at home against the Brewers. Bettors on Milwaukee at +112 on the moneyline collected their winnings from that game, while the total score (5) sent UNDER bettors home happy as well. Pittsburgh lost in extra innings against the Brewers on Sunday as Milwaukee edged them 3-2 at PNC Park.
